When Is the Best Time to Plant Plumeria?
The best time to plant Plumeria is during the warmer months when the risk of frost has passed. Spring and early summer are ideal, as the plant can establish its roots in the favorable growing conditions. Planting during this period gives your Plumeria a strong start and prepares it for healthy growth.
